The development of action games has always been spurred by technological advancements. The leap from 2D pixel graphics to 3D open-world experiences has redefined how stories are told and experienced. Developers utilize cutting-edge graphics, physics engines, and AI to craft immersive worlds filled with dynamic characters and engaging narratives. Players are no longer passive participants; they are active agents shaping the course of their virtual adventures.

Moreover, the social aspect of action games cannot be overlooked. Multiplayer modes allow gamers to connect, cooperate, and compete with others worldwide. The rise of eSports has further elevated action games into a professional realm, where skill and strategy are rewarded with fame and fortune. Competitions draw massive audiences, both online and in physical venues, highlighting the global appeal of this genre.
